Blue Angel for Döllken solidcore skirting boards

The Döllken solidcore skirting boards have been awarded the Blue Angel, the best-known eco-label of the Federal Government.

A customer's confidence in a quality of a product, whether it is private customers, builders, architects or general contractors, is of great importance, especially in the present time. Seals of quality and awards serve the customer for orientation and distinguish high-quality from conventional products.

The Blue Angel has been the federal government's eco-label for more than 40 years. Independently and credibly, it sets demanding standards for environmentally friendly products and services. The Blue Angel is thus an important point of reference for many customers when it comes to sustainable purchasing. Only a few construction products receive the coveted signet, whose independent jury consists of representatives of environmental and consumer associations, trade unions, industry, trade, crafts, municipalities, science, media, churches, youth and federal states.

The RAL GmbH as a sign-issuing agency currently awards almost the entire range of Döllken solidcore skirting boards with the coveted Blue Angel. The jury considers the following advantages of the product range to be particularly valuable for the environment and health: the products that have been indispensable for many publishers for several decades are low in emissions and harmful substances and therefore do not pose health problems in the residential environment. In addition, the wood used has been proven to come from sustainable forestry.

The jury writes: "The solidcore skirting boards of Döllken Profiles are unique. High-quality cores made of FSC-certified softwood fibres are coated with high-performance polymers, making the solidcore base strips very robust. All solidcore skirting boards can be punched and professionally processed with system tools. The result: a perfect bottom finish that still brings joy after years."

Safe and widely certified

But not only the systemically processable core skirting boards of the company were awarded, also the soft skirting boards received the coveted award with the laurel wreath, which has been awarded since 1978. At Döllken Profiles, responsibility for the environment and health is not a lip service, but part of the company's sustainability philosophy. The careful use of resources is a top priority at Döllken. Thus, all production residues that are produced during the production of skirting boards and profiles (plastics and printing inks) are collected in a pure variety, as well as processed as far as possible and recycled internally. Furthermore, all Döllken products meet the strictest requirements for the emission reduction of pollutants into the indoor air and can be safely used in sensitive environments, such as kindergartens.

According to the Federal Environment Agency, products and services that are awarded the Blue Angel are more environmentally friendly than comparable, conventional products and services. For each product group, there are specific criteria that must meet the products and services marked with the Blue Angel. Depending on the product group, this can be, for example, the prohibition of hazardous chemicals or low energy consumption. In order to reflect the technical development, the Federal Environment Agency reviews the criteria every three to four years. The Blue Angel is currently available for 120 different product groups.
